I have been doing stand-up comedy since
the summer of 2000.
I've now done over 800 shows. I now do regular 10-20 min spots at The
Comedy Store (London and Manchester) , Up the Creek, The Amused Moose, The Comedy
Café, Downstairs at the Kings Head and The Chuckle Club.
I have also done gigs at Imperial, Brunel, Middlesex and Queen Margaret
Universities.
